NSDC International forges partnerships for cross-border skills in Germany

NSDC International, a subsidiary of the National Skill Development Corporation (NSDC), is advancing global workforce development by forging strategic skill partnerships during its recent delegation visit to Germany. The delegation participated in the OAV Conference in Hamburg, where representatives from countries like India, Sri Lanka, Malaysia, and Indonesia gathered to discuss cross-border skill development.

NSDC International emphasized the importance of aligning skill training with industry needs to ensure employability in rapidly evolving job markets. CEO Shri Alok Kumar stated, “Our partnerships with German industries are key in bridging skill gaps and empowering Indian talent for international careers.” The delegation engaged in key roundtable discussions with German employers and training providers, focusing on enhancing the employability of Indian youth in sectors such as engineering, healthcare, and technology.

The delegation also visited a leading railway infrastructure academy in Germany, learning from their hands-on training models to address sector-specific workforce shortages, with over 98,000 vacancies in Germany’s railway sector alone.
